1. Benefits of Appointment Reservation Appointment reservation offers numerous benefits for both businesses and customers. For businesses, it provides a clear picture of future demand, enabling them to adjust production and resource allocation accordingly. This, in turn, helps reduce waste, optimize inventory, and increase customer satisfaction. On the other hand, appointment reservation is a game-changer for customers. It allows them to plan their visits in advance, avoiding long wait times or last-minute cancellations. This leads to increased customer loyalty and retention, as well as improved overall satisfaction with the business. 2. How Appointment Reservation Works Appointment reservation typically involves a combination of digital tools and human interaction. Businesses can use online scheduling platforms or mobile apps to allow customers to book appointments in advance. These platforms often integrate with existing systems, streamlining the booking process and reducing errors. Once an appointment is booked, businesses can assign specific timeslots and resources accordingly. This ensures that every customer receives a personalized experience, tailored to their needs and preferences. Furthermore, appointment reservation allows businesses to track customer behavior, identify trends, and make data-driven decisions to improve services. 3. This leads to increased customer satisfaction and loyalty. 5. Challenges of Implementing Appointment Reservation Implementing an appointment reservation system can be challenging for some businesses. The primary hurdle is often the initial investment required to set up a new system. Additionally, businesses may need to adjust their existing workflows and processes to accommodate the new technology. Another challenge is ensuring customer buy-in and adoption. Some customers may resist changing their traditional booking methods or require assistance with learning new systems. Businesses must therefore invest time and resources in educating customers about the benefits of digital appointment reservation. 6. Tips for Implementing Appointment Reservation Successfully Implementing appointment reservation successfully requires careful planning, execution, and ongoing support. Here are some tips to help businesses get started: * Start small: Begin by introducing appointment reservation on a limited scale, gradually scaling up as needed. * Invest in training: Educate employees on the new system and provide ongoing support to ensure a seamless experience for customers. * Monitor performance: Track key metrics, such as booking rates and customer satisfaction, to refine the system and improve outcomes.
